Does anybody know how to pass non self-evaluating symbol arguments to PWGL functions? See the attach file to show an example of the malfunctioning of some of the PWGL objects to pass symbol arguments to a CASE lisp function. As you can see, the body of the function in the LISP-CODE-BOX, expects a non self-evaluating symbol argument, that's what is supposed to be the output of the TEXT, VALUE and EVAL boxes, but once the main function is called it always evaluates to NIL. This behavior would not occur in flat LispWorks code.
Any hints to solve the problem in the PWGL environment?
